The American Heritage® Dictionary of the English Language, 4th Edition
  • n. The act or process of accepting.
  • n. The state of being accepted or acceptable.
  • n. Favorable reception; approval.
  • n. Belief in something; agreement.
  • n. A formal indication by a debtor of willingness to pay a time draft or bill of exchange.
  • n. A written instrument so accepted.
  • n. Law Compliance by one party with the terms and conditions of another's offer so that a contract becomes legally binding between them.
